Tsunami are waves caused by sudden movement of the ocean surface due to earthquakes, landslides on the sea floor, land slumping into the ocean, large volcanic eruptions or meteorite impact in the ocean.

<h3>Give a brief account on group development.</h3>
Finding out why and how small groups evolve over time is the main objective of most group development studies. A group's cohesiveness, the nature and frequency of its activities, the quality of the work it produces, and the presence of group conflict. To describe how certain groups change through time, a number of theoretical models have been proposed. Sometimes, like in the case of therapeutic groups, the kind of group being studied had an impact on the suggested model of group development.
One of the most commonly referenced models of group growth was created by Bruce Tuckman in the middle of the 1960s after reviewing roughly fifty studies on group development. According to Tuckman's model of group growth, a group will go through four linear stages in its unitary sequence of decision-making: forming, storming, norming, and performing. When a fresh batch of trials were examined in 1977, a fifth stage—adjourning—was added.

The term cognitive dissonance is used to describe the mental discomfort that results from holding two conflicting beliefs, values, or attitudes. ... This inconsistency between what people believe and how they behave motivates people to engage in actions that will help minimize feelings of discomfort.
